前几天同事提及oracle的一个报错:ORA-00845: MEMORY_TARGET not supported on this system,数据库启动不了,这个问题之前遇到过,现在总结一下,免得我忘性大。。。 memory_targetoracle 11g新引进的一个自动内存管理特性,可以解释为memory_target=SGA+PGA。设置memory_target参数后,oracle
原创 2012-12-10 09:45:54
698阅读
  1.内存减小导致Oracle启动不了   Last login: Sun Nov  4 15:09:06 2012 from 192.168.5.222 [oracle@h1 ~]$ sqlplus "/as SYSDBA"   SQL*Plus: Release 11.2.0.1.0 Production on S
转载 精选 2012-12-17 10:50:00
476阅读
http://www.cnblogs.com/killkill/archive/2010/09/10/1823690.html
转载 精选 2015-05-24 17:45:56
507阅读
ORACLE报错(2)MEMORY_TARGET not supported on this systemparameters   Oracle9i引入pga_aggregate_target,可以自动对PGA进行调整;Oracle10引入sga_target,可以自动对SGA进行调整。Ora
原创 2010-11-29 15:05:09
970阅读
oracle 11g中新增的内存自动管理的参数MEMORY_TARGET,它能自动调整SGA和PGA,这个特性需要用到/dev/shm共享文件系统,而且要求/dev/shm必须大于MEMORY_TARGET,如果/dev/shm比MEMORY_TARGET小,就会报错。解决方法:1.初始化参数MEMORY_TARGETMEMORY_MAX_TARGET不能大于共享内存(/dev/shm),为了解决这个问题,可以增大/dev/shmmount -t tmpfs shmfs -o size=122.
原创 2021-08-09 17:34:36
398阅读
oracle 11g中新增的内存自动管理的参数MEMORY_TARGET,它能自动调整SGA和PGA,这个特性需要用到/dev/shm共享文件系统,而且要求/dev/shm必须大于MEMORY_TARGET,如果/dev/shm比MEMORY_TARGET小,就会报错。解决方法:
转载 2022-02-09 14:44:27
193阅读
修改Oraclememory_max_targetmemory_target最初安装Orale11g时,采用默认自动内存管理,使用1/2Mem。后来想增大最大内存使用值。系统内存16G Mem,想修改为3/4Mem: 16*3/4=12G=12288M。# vim /etc/sysctl.confkernel.shmmax = 12884901888# sysctl -p...
转载 2022-04-06 16:11:36
936阅读
修改Oraclememory_max_targetmemory_target最初安装Orale11g时,采用默认自动内存管理,使用1/2Mem。后来想增大最大内存使用值。系统内存16G Mem,想修改为3/4Mem: 16*3/4=12G=12288M。# vim /etc/sysctl.confkernel.shmmax = 12884901888# sysctl -p...
转载 2021-08-09 18:15:34
113阅读
首先了解一下我们为什么要修改虚拟内存?虚拟内存有什么用?在内存足够大的情况下还要设置虚拟内存吗?1、如果计算机缺少运行程序或操作所需的随机存取内存 (RAM),则 Windows 使用虚拟内存进行补偿。2、虚拟内存将计算机的 RAM 和硬盘上的临时空间组合在一起。当 RAM 运行速度缓慢时,虚拟内存将数据从 RAM 移动到称为分页文件的空间中。将数据移入与移出分页文件可以释放 RAM,以便计算机可
ORACLE 修改 MEMORY_TARGET ,ORA-00845: MEMORY_TARGET not supported on this system ,ORA-02095: specified initialization parameter cannot be modified,ORA-32001: write to SPFILE requested but no SPFILE is in use
自动内存管理是用两个初始化参数进行配置的:  MEMORY_TARGET:动态控制SGA和PGA时,Oracle总共可以使用的共享内存大小,这个参数是动态的,因此提供给Oracle的内存总量是可以动态增大,也可以动态减小的。它不能超过MEMORY_MAX_TARGET参数设置的大小。默认值是0。  MEMORY_MAX_TARGET:这个参数定义了MEMORY_TARGET最大可以达到而不用重启实
原创 2016-09-29 10:00:26
7369阅读
Oracle 9i引入pga_aggregate_target,可以自动对PGA进行调整; Oracle 10g引入sga_target,可以自动对SGA进行调整; Oracle 11g则对这两部分进行综合,引入
转载 2022-04-06 16:17:12
565阅读
Oracle 9i引入pga_aggregate_target,可以自动对PGA进行调整; Oracle 10g引入sga_target,可以自动对SGA进行调整; Oracle 11g则对这两部分进行综合,引入memory_target,可以自动调整所有的内存,这就是新引入的自动内存管理特性。自动内存管理是用两个初始化参数进行配置的:  MEMORY_TARGET:动...
转载 2021-08-09 22:39:06
1022阅读
Oracle 9i引入pga_aggregate_target,可以自动对PGA进行调整;   Oracle 10g引入sga_target,可以自动对SGA进行调整;
转载 2022-08-17 01:00:37
198阅读
一、引言: Oracle 9i引入pga_aggregate_target,可以自动对PGA进行调整; Oracle 10g引入sga_target,可以自动对SGA进行调整; Oracle 11g则对这两部分进行综合,引入memory_target,可以自动调整所有的内存,这就是新引入的自动内存管...
原创 2021-07-30 14:18:59
532阅读
memory_max_target/memory_target/sga_max_size/sga_target
原创 2012-09-16 13:22:27
2097阅读
      在这个网络技术飞速发展的时代,隐私安全成为生活中人们不可忽悠的一部分,再加上现在网络技术疯狂发展的时代,怎么样保护自己的隐私安全成了一个不可缺少的一部分,对于自己的隐私安全都肯定是希望自己的隐私不被泄露,都肯定有这种经历吧?就是有时候接到一些莫名奇妙的电话,那个时候肯定没有想过这是什么原因,那么现在隐私专家可以很明确的和你说,你的隐私被泄露了,那么你一定在
Linux系统是一种开源操作系统,拥有众多的衍生版本,其中最为流行的是Red Hat Linux。Red Hat Linux是一个专为企业用户设计的Linux发行版,提供了丰富的功能和优秀的性能。 在Red Hat Linux中,有一个重要的参数叫做memory_target,它决定了系统可以使用的内存大小。memory_target参数的设置对系统的性能和稳定性有着重要的影响,因此需要合理地配
原创 2024-04-24 10:17:30
33阅读
ORACLE 报错:ORA-00845: MEMORY_TARGET not supported on this system Oralce11:startup时报错: SQL> startup ORA-00845: M
原创 2010-11-29 15:07:21
904阅读
11g中新增MEMORY_MAX_TARGET参数,此参数一出现就如在10g中第一次出现SG
原创 2022-12-02 10:19:56
222阅读
  • 1
  • 2
  • 3
  • 4
  • 5